Appeal
for Witnesses
Write a statement - including your name,
nationality, date of birth, contact details, how
you were treated, how you saw other people being
treated, and if you have any witnesses and
send it to the Legal Team, Amnesty International
in your home country (if it concerns events
inside the jail), your countrys consulate
in Prague, and the Czech Embassy in your country.

International Support
If you're outside the Czech Republic, organize a
rally at the Czech embassy in your country. A
large group of Spaniards pressured the Czech
Embassy in Spain to release Spanish protestors
from jail. On September 28, Spanish protestors
were released, but many chose to stay in jail as
an act of jail solidarity, demanding that
arrested protestors of other nationalities get
the same treatment. Similar protests outside of
Czech embassies have been organized in Barcelona,
Paris and Oslo.
